Transaction 791139d06f7b91387f6c882162d93f89377f623f64116ea29f0f1a2bb7418469
1 Input
1 Output
-
791139d06f7b91387f6c882162d93f89377f623f64116ea29f0f1a2bb7418469:0
- value
- 3399032
- script pubkey
- OP_0 OP_PUSHBYTES_32 31fffd50627057c64f624eb4350c9555e28f73cdd425ffe0e916be9fffe3929f
- address
- bc1qx8ll65rzwptuvnmzf66r2ry42h3g7u7d6sjllc8fz6lflllrj20slvnsqg